As nouns, amnestic aphasia is a hyponym of aphasia; that is, amnestic aphasia is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than aphasia:
  • aphasia: inability to use or understand language (spoken or written) because of a brain lesion
  • amnestic aphasia: inability to name objects or to recognize written or spoken names of objects
